The term filler refers to a type of episode in an anime that is not part of the original source material, such as manga or light novels. Instead, fillers are created to extend the length of the anime, allowing it to catch up to the source material or to provide a break for the production team. While some filler episodes are well-received, others can feel unnecessary and disrupt the flow of the story.

The Definition of Filler Episodes

Understanding what constitutes a filler episode is crucial in unraveling the mystery behind their significance. A filler episode is an additional episode inserted into the anime series that is not adapted from the original manga storyline.

The Purpose of Filler Episodes

Filler episodes serve several purposes, and one of them is to give the anime series time to catch up with the manga storyline. They also provide a platform for character development, world-building, and adding suspense, creating a balance between the major story arcs.

The Arrangement of Filler Episodes

Filler episodes are often arranged at particular points in the series, usually between major story arcs or before a new arc begins. In Naruto, these episodes are marked as Naruto Original or Non-canon.

The Impact of Filler Episodes on the Series

Filler episodes can have both positive and negative effects on the anime series. On the one hand, they may provide a break from the main storyline, introducing humor and character development. On the other hand, they may disrupt the flow of the show and cause fans to lose interest.

  1. What are Naruto filler episodes?

    Filler episodes in Naruto are anime episodes that deviate from the original manga storyline. They are created to give the manga more time to be produced, and to keep the anime series running without catching up to the manga's release.

  2. Why are Naruto fillers important?

    Naruto fillers are important because they allow for character development and world-building that may not have been explored in the manga. This extra content can also add depth to the overall story and create a more immersive experience for viewers.

  3. Do Naruto fillers impact the main storyline?

    No, Naruto fillers do not directly impact the main storyline of the manga. However, some filler episodes may contain small nods to the main story or foreshadowing of future events.

  4. How do I know which episodes are Naruto fillers?

    You can find lists online that distinguish between filler and canon episodes. It is recommended to watch the canon episodes for the main storyline and only watch filler episodes if you are interested in the extra content.

  5. Should I skip Naruto fillers?

    It is ultimately up to personal preference whether or not to skip Naruto fillers. Some fans enjoy the additional content and character development, while others prefer to stick to the main storyline. Skipping fillers will not affect your understanding of the main story.
